Using High-Quality Voice Samples

Choosing professional voice actors

When it comes to creating exceptional audio quality in text-to-speech software, one of the fundamental factors is selecting professional voice actors. These individuals possess the necessary expertise and skills to deliver high-quality voice samples. They understand the nuances of intonation, pronunciation, and expressiveness required to create natural and engaging speech. By working with professional voice actors, the software developers can ensure that the voice samples are of the highest standard.

Ensuring natural and expressive speech

Another crucial aspect of achieving exceptional audio quality is ensuring that the voice samples sound natural and expressive. Human speech is complex and dynamic, with variations in pitch, tempo, and emphasis. By capturing these nuances in the voice samples, the text-to-speech software can produce realistic and engaging speech output. Professionals in the field of speech synthesis employ techniques like prosody modeling to mimic the natural prosodic features of human speech, such as stress, rhythm, and intonation.

Implementing Advanced Speech Synthesis Techniques

Leveraging deep learning algorithms

One of the key advancements in speech synthesis technology in recent years is the integration of deep learning algorithms. By leveraging deep neural networks, text-to-speech software can learn and model the relationships between linguistic input and audio output. This enables the system to generate more natural and coherent speech, thereby enhancing the audio quality. Deep learning algorithms have proven to be highly effective in capturing the subtleties of human speech and producing more realistic synthetic voices.

Utilizing neural networks for improved naturalness

Neural networks play a crucial role in the advancement of speech synthesis techniques. By utilizing neural networks, text-to-speech software can improve the naturalness of speech output. These networks are trained on large datasets to capture patterns in human speech, including phonetics, intonation, and rhythm. As a result, the software can generate more natural-sounding speech that closely resembles human speech patterns. Utilizing neural networks allows for significant improvements in the audio quality and overall user experience.

Employing prosody modeling techniques

Prosody modeling is an essential technique in speech synthesis that focuses on capturing the rhythmic and melodic aspects of human speech. By employing prosody modeling techniques, text-to-speech software can infuse its speech output with the appropriate stress, rhythm, and intonation. This creates a more engaging and natural audio experience for the user. Prosody modeling contributes significantly to enhancing the overall audio quality of the software and allows for more expressive and lifelike synthetic voices.

Optimizing Audio Processing and Data Compression

Reducing background noise and interference

To ensure exceptional audio quality in text-to-speech software, it is crucial to reduce background noise and interference in the audio output. Background noise can degrade the clarity and intelligibility of the speech, making it difficult for users to understand. By implementing advanced audio processing techniques, such as noise reduction algorithms, the software can suppress unwanted noise and enhance the overall quality of the audio. This ensures that the speech output is clear and easily understandable, even in noisy environments.

Enhancing volume and clarity

Audio volume and clarity are essential factors in delivering exceptional audio quality. The software should be designed to optimize the volume level of the speech output, ensuring that it is audible without being too loud or too soft. Additionally, the software should enhance the clarity of the speech, minimizing any distortions or muffled sounds. By employing techniques like equalization and sound normalization, the text-to-speech software can deliver balanced and clear audio, enhancing the user’s listening experience.

Applying dynamic range compression

Dynamic range compression is a technique that helps to maintain a consistent volume level throughout the speech output. It reduces the disparity between the loudest and softest parts of the audio, ensuring that all parts of the speech are audible and clear. This technique is particularly useful in situations where the text-to-speech software is used in environments with varying background noise levels. By applying dynamic range compression, the software can adapt to different listening conditions and provide a consistent audio experience to the user.

Personalizing and Customizing Audio Output

Allowing users to adjust voice parameters

One effective way to enhance audio quality in text-to-speech software is by allowing users to adjust voice parameters according to their preferences. This could include attributes such as pitch, speaking rate, and volume. By providing users with the ability to customize these parameters, the software can deliver a more personalized and enjoyable audio experience. Users can tailor the voice output to their liking, ensuring that the audio quality aligns with their individual preferences.

Offering accent and language options

To cater to a global user base, text-to-speech software should provide accent and language options. Users from different regions and cultures may have specific accent and language requirements. By offering a variety of accents and languages, the software can ensure that users can generate speech output that reflects their preferred accent or language. This level of customization enhances the audio quality for users from diverse backgrounds and improves their overall experience with the software.

Facilitating speech rate and pitch customization

In addition to adjusting voice parameters, allowing users to customize the speech rate and pitch can significantly enhance the audio quality in text-to-speech software. Users may prefer a slower or faster speaking rate, depending on their needs and preferences. Pitch customization can also add variety and depth to the voice output. By providing options for speech rate and pitch customization, the software allows users to fine-tune the audio output, resulting in exceptional audio quality tailored to their liking.

Considering Natural Language Processing

Enhancing phonetic recognition and intonation

Natural language processing (NLP) techniques play a vital role in improving audio quality in text-to-speech software. By enhancing phonetic recognition, the software can accurately pronounce words and minimize mispronunciations. NLP algorithms can analyze the context and phonetic rules to ensure that the speech output sounds natural and intelligible. Additionally, NLP can enhance intonation to mimic the natural rise and fall of pitch in human speech, further enhancing the audio quality and overall realism of the speech output.

Providing context-awareness and emotion detection

To make the speech output more engaging and human-like, incorporating context-awareness and emotion detection in text-to-speech software is essential. Context-awareness allows the software to understand the context of the spoken words and adjust pronunciation, pacing, and emphasis accordingly. Emotion detection enables the software to infuse the speech output with appropriate emotional tones, improving the expressiveness and audio quality. By incorporating these features, the software can produce speech output that is more dynamic, engaging, and faithful to natural human speech.

Implementing language-specific model variations

Different languages have unique linguistic characteristics that affect the audio quality of text-to-speech software. By implementing language-specific model variations, the software can account for these linguistic nuances and produce more accurate and natural-sounding speech. The models can be trained to capture language-specific phonetics, rhythms, and intonations, resulting in superior audio quality for each language. This customization ensures that users in different linguistic communities can enjoy exceptional audio quality in their preferred language.

Maintaining Scalability and Performance

Optimizing for real-time processing

To deliver exceptional audio quality, text-to-speech software should be optimized for real-time processing. Users expect prompt and seamless speech output, especially in applications that require instant speech synthesis, such as voice assistants. Optimization techniques like multithreading, caching, and efficient memory management can reduce latency and enable real-time speech synthesis. By optimizing for real-time processing, the software can meet user expectations for high-quality audio output without any noticeable delays.

Handling large-scale text-to-speech conversion

In scenarios where text-to-speech software needs to handle large-scale text-to-speech conversion, scalability becomes a crucial consideration. The software should be designed to efficiently process and synthesize large volumes of text without compromising audio quality. This requires optimizing algorithms, memory allocation, and processing strategies to handle the scale of the task. By ensuring scalability, the software can produce exceptional audio quality consistently, even when dealing with significant workloads.

Implementing efficient caching and buffering mechanisms

Efficient caching and buffering mechanisms are vital for maintaining high performance and exceptional audio quality in text-to-speech software. By intelligently caching frequently accessed data and buffering audio samples, the software can minimize processing overheads and deliver audio output promptly. These mechanisms reduce latency and ensure a smooth and uninterrupted listening experience for the user. Implementing efficient caching and buffering contributes to the overall perceived audio quality of the software.
